Purchase of Baled Recycling - FY27
Solicitation # 2027-IFB-018
Wicomico County, through its Public Works Solid Waste Division, is soliciting bids under solicitation number 2027-IFB-018 for the purchase of baled recycling materials for Fiscal Year 2027. The contract involves the removal and disposal of recyclable materials, including old corrugated cardboard (OCC), baled PET, baled mixed plastics #1-7, and baled HDPE natural, from the Newland Park Landfill located in Salisbury, Maryland. The County intends to award the contract to the responsible and responsive vendor offering the highest price per short ton. The performance period is scheduled from September 24, 2026, through March 16, 2026. Qualified vendors must be licensed to operate in the state of Maryland and provide a Certificate of Status from the Maryland Department of Assessments and Taxation. Bidders are required to submit an Affidavit of Qualification to Bid and a pricing table per short ton via the OpenGov e-Procurement Portal by September 22, 2026, at 2:30 pm. The successful contractor is responsible for providing transportation for the materials, which will be loaded by landfill employees. Tonnage for invoicing will be determined using the County's certified scales, with payments issued within 30 days of receipt of a proper invoice. The agreement is subject to standard Wicomico County terms and conditions, including specific insurance requirements and a three-year record retention policy.

The contract is for the supply of structured cabling materials and components including Cat 6a copper cabling, fiber optic cables, patch panels, jacks, conduits, and related low-voltage infrastructure, all of which must comply with TIA/EIA-568 standards to ensure interoperability, performance, and reliability in network installations. The scope encompasses the provision of all necessary hardware and accessories required for a fully compliant structured cabling system, suitable for deployment in enterprise and academic environments. Deliverables must meet rigorous industry specifications for bandwidth, signal integrity, and durability under typical indoor installation conditions. The solicitation is issued as a subcontract under the University of Houston – Clear Lake, located in Texas, with a response deadline of July 21, 2026. The North American Industry Classification System code 423930 indicates the focus is on telecommunications equipment and supplies merchant wholesalers. The opportunity is accessible via the Texas SmartBuy portal, and while no specific place of performance or point of contact is provided, suppliers must be prepared to deliver materials that align with the university’s infrastructure needs and timelines, potentially supporting campus-wide network upgrades or new construction projects.
